Abstract

The utility model discloses a standard size window auxiliary frame structure. The standard size window auxiliary frame structure comprises a wall hole formed by a window frame prefabricating formwork for buildings, wherein a window frame in which an inner window is installed is installed in the wall hole and comprises folding parts surrounding the wall hole and an inner window installation part; the folding parts are fixed on a wall; the inner window installation part protruding out of the wall is formed between the two folding parts; connecting parts used for connecting the inner window installation part with the folding parts are arranged between the inner window installation part and the folding parts; a cavity for accommodating a wall withdrawal edge is formed between the two connecting parts; a hook is arranged at the tail end of each folding part; a baffle is arranged outside the inner window, protrudes out of the installing surface of the inner window and pushes against the inner window installation part; a locating plate is arranged inside the inner window and is provided with a plurality of sliding chutes; a fixing element protruding out of the installing surface of the inner window is installed in each sliding chute; the inner window installation part is arranged between the baffle and the fixing element. The standard size window auxiliary frame structure achieves standard batch production and quick installation, is low in cost, improves the working efficiency and reduces the labor capacity.

Background technology
At present, on the building doors and windows market of China, the size of window is not that standard is made, and is substantially while building body of wall, to reserve wall hole, then in-site measurement wall hole size, according to the size of wall hole, make the window with window frame, the window finally size being differed is arranged on corresponding wall hole, and due to the deviation of building size, measured wall hole dimensional errors is larger, thereby cause the size of wall hole nonstandard, affect the manufactured size of building doors and windows; In architectural process, use window frame template simultaneously, because window frame template is provided with, make ,Gai inclined-plane, inclined-plane that this window frame template is convenient to remove contact and form body of wall with body of wall on body of wall to move back and unload limit, can affect equally the manufactured size of building doors and windows; Thereby the equal disunity of size of each door and window, cannot realize door and window standardized production in building, and the process that door and window is made is loaded down with trivial details, thereby causes workers processing labour intensity and the amount of labour to increase; During installation, major part is by swell fixture, expansion bolt or nailing, window frame to be arranged on body of wall, then sash is arranged in window frame, and such mounting means not only cost is high, and complexity is installed, also need to be by instrument; Meanwhile, a people cannot complete the installation task of door and window at all, and installation effectiveness reduces.
